21 Cig Value
 
I am getting ready to sell my 1986 21' Cigarette with a stock 7.4 liter with IMCO center riser manifolds and stainless elbows, Hynautic steering, 24" tabs and Bravo one drive. It has a matching red double axle trailer, nice white with red classic Cig trim scheme throughout the boat.

I never see one of these for sale ... they seem very rare, what can I get for the boat and trailer?? what is a clean one worth?? Thanks, Mike :confused:

I was thinking of asking $16-18K but I'm really not sure what one is worth. I had a 18 Donzi (also loved that boat) and know they sell in the mid-high teens, but this is very special compared to the very common 18 Donzi. Also this boat is so much bigger than a 20 Cig or 18 Donzi, I actually have a Porta-Potti in the cabin area (access through hatch). Much more width and freeboard and weight - closer to a 211 Four Winns Liberator.

The options on the boat with Hynautic and the IMCO exhaust and a Bravo drive should add value as well.

It's in great shape .... I get a ton of nice comments everywhere I go with it ..... it's kind of like a classic muscle car in boat form.
